SB 1273·PA·senate

An Act amending Title 74 (Transportation) of the Pennsylvania Consolidated Statutes, in turnpike, further providing for electronic toll collection.

Summary

The bill adds language to Pennsylvania’s electronic toll‑collection privacy statute, clarifying that toll data may be provided to law‑enforcement when it helps locate abducted children or missing persons identified through the state’s Amber Alert system. It affects toll‑road operators and drivers by expanding lawful data disclosures, and it aids police investigations. The change takes effect 60 days after enactment.
